Ella Sonksen

November 14, 1917 — October 19, 2009

Ella Katherine Sonksen, age 91, of Carroll and formerly of Manning passed away on Monday, October 19, 2009 at the Carroll Health Center. Funeral services will be held 10:30 A.M. on Friday, October 23, 2009 at St. Paul Lutheran Church in Carroll with Rev. David Anthony and Rev. Brian Licht officiating. Organist for the service will be Janet Hoff. Friends may call at the Dahn and Woodhouse Funeral Home in Carroll after 5:00 P.M. on Thursday where there will be a prayer service held at 7:00 P.M. The casket will be moved to the church at 8:30 A.M. on Friday to lie in state until the time of service. Casket bearers will be Anthony Leo, Larry Muhlbauer, Ron Muhlbauer, Russ Stribe, Gene Muhlbauer, Vern Langbein, Allen Fara, and Mike Fara. Honorary casket bearers will be Dwight Fiscus, Dale Quandt, Elmer Wiederin, Earl Singsank, John Stewart, Bud Mosman, Mark Gray and Karl Albertsen. Burial will be in the Manning Cemetery. Born on November 14, 1917 at Lincoln Township, Iowa, she was the daughter of William G. and Katie (Paulsen) Musfeldt. She grew up in Audubon county and attended Lincoln Center School. She was married to Henry M. Sonksen on January 4, 1940 at Zion Lutheran Church in Manning. She has been a resident of the Carroll Health Center for the past three years. Ella was a member of St. Paul Lutheran Church. In her spare time she enjoyed caneing, china painting, sewing, cooking, and helping her husband on the farm. Surviving are her husband Henry M. Sonksen of Carroll; a daughter Marilyn D. Lohmeier of Des Moines; a sister Doris Warren and her husband Lawrence of Trenton, Missouri; a granddaughter Nancy Allison and her husband Jeff of Stillwell, Kansas; a granddaughter Lori Leo and her husband John of Des Moines, Iowa; and six great grandchildren: Anthony, Adriano, Alessandra, Annamaria, Jenifer, and Sarah. Ella was preceded in death by her parents, brothers Henry, William, and Arnold, and a sister Elsie Puck.
